Commit 7a278e17 authored by jianglx's avatar jianglx

Merge branch 'dev_im' of http://113.105.137.151:22280/lify/rvapp into dev-john-im-improve

parents acdf844c d513b651
......@@ -8,8 +8,8 @@ android {
minSdkVersion rootProject.ext.minSdkVersion
targetSdkVersion rootProject.ext.targetSdkVersion
flavorDimensions "default"
versionCode 150
versionName "1.5.0"
versionCode 154
versionName "1.5.4"
multiDexEnabled true
......
......@@ -106,7 +106,7 @@ public class CustomerListActivity extends BaseStatusActivity<CommonPresenter> im
if (Build.VERSION.SDK_INT >= Build.VERSION_CODES.M) {
if (!Settings.canDrawOverlays(this)) {
new AlertDialog.Builder(this).setTitle("提示")
.setMessage("允许滴房车在其他应用上层显示,实时获知新消息")
.setMessage("允许在手机上层显示,实时获知新消息")
.setNegativeButton("下次再说", (dialogInterface, i) -> {
dialogInterface.dismiss();
}).setPositiveButton("好的", (dialogInterface, i) -> {
......
package com.rv.im.bean;
import com.ruiwenliu.wrapper.base.BaseBean;
public class ImBaseBean extends BaseBean {
public transient int status;
public transient String message;
}
package com.rv.im.bean;
import com.google.gson.annotations.SerializedName;
import java.util.List;
/**
* 用户表
*/
public class User extends ImBaseBean {
private UserData data ;
public UserData getData() {
return data;
}
public void setData(UserData data) {
this.data = data;
}
public class UserData{
private String userId ;
private String telephone ;
private String phone ;
private int onlinestate ;
public String getUserId() {
return userId;
}
public void setUserId(String userId) {
this.userId = userId;
}
public String getTelephone() {
return telephone;
}
public void setTelephone(String telephone) {
this.telephone = telephone;
}
public String getPhone() {
return phone;
}
public void setPhone(String phone) {
this.phone = phone;
}
public int getOnlinestate() {
return onlinestate;
}
public void setOnlinestate(int onlinestate) {
this.onlinestate = onlinestate;
}
}
}
package com.rv.im.util;
import java.util.TimerTask;
public class RvImTimerTask extends TimerTask {
private TimerListener listener;
public RvImTimerTask(TimerListener listener) {
this.listener = listener;
}
@Override
public void run() {
if (listener != null)
listener.timer();
}
public interface TimerListener {
void timer();
}
}
......@@ -103,7 +103,7 @@ public class TitleTextWindow implements View.OnTouchListener {
createTitleView();
animShow();
//3S后自动关闭
mHander.sendEmptyMessageDelayed(20, 1000);
mHander.sendEmptyMessageDelayed(20, 2000);
}
/**
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ment